As a suggestion to maybe appease those who think it is a bit too slow (count me as one, but only marginally), perhaps you could increase the tick cap for offline accumulation. I cap at 57,600 ticks, which at my current tick rate (8/sec) equates to only 2 hours of up-time. When I am offline for 20 hours a day (work and that pesky thing called sleep that all humans need), you can see how I feel that it's not progressing as fast as it should.
I also agree with red_legends' suggestion of a blueprint mode, but I'd also suggest adding a feature where you can manually set the level of your pieces instead of just taking the upgrade level you are currently at. That way, you could figure out how to reorganize your factory before you purchase your upgrades and start hemorrhaging money.
